About
- Robert E. Helpern is a founding partner of the firm's Real Estate practice
- For more than thirty years, Bob has leveraged his legal experience to identify key issues and craft creative solutions for clients including real estate funds, banks, developers, owners of commercial and multi-family properties, and tenants
- Bob has been involved in acquisitions and sales, leasing, joint ventures, mortgage and mezzanine financing, and restructuring of debt
- Representative clients include one of the largest owner/developers of shopping centers in the United States, one of the largest New York City hospitals, and private equity funds managed by former real estate partners from major law firms
- Bob has been selected for inclusion in Super Lawyers for the New York Metro Areas, beginning in 2006 through 2022, each year that selections were made
